 WHERE TO GO

 New Orleans:
Jean Lafitte National Historic Park and Preserve
, (at the Barataria Preserve: canoeing, bird watching, trail walks. At Chalmette Battlefield: historical tours). Visitor's center in the French Quarter: 419 Decatur St. 504-589-2133

French Quarter, (Visit historic homes, cathedrals, cemeteries, and squares, or see the French Market, Flea Market, and Historic Voodoo Museum). Between Canal St. and Esplanade Ave., east of I-10 and Louis Armstrong Park. Visitor's Center: 419 Decatur St. 504-589-2636

Westwego:
Bayou Segnette State Park
, (boating, canoeing, fishing, wave pool, wildlife viewing, bird watching). From I-10 (New Orleans), take I-310 south across the Luling Bridge and exit US 90 east. US 90 becomes Westbank Expressway. Follow toward Westwego. 877-226-7652

Fort Pike (War of 1812 and Civil War historic fort. Reenactments, museum, self-guided tours). From New Orleans, take US 90 south. 504-662-5703
